Abstract

The present specification discloses a payment verification method and system. A payee device generates verification information for a target payment transaction and provides the verification information to a payer device through a wireless signal. The payer device generates payment information and provides the payment information to the payee device, wherein the payment information carries the payer account information and the obtained verification information. After obtaining the payment information, the payee device matches and verifies the verification information carried in the payment information with the locally generated verification information. If the verification is successful, the target payment transaction is completed by using the account information carried in the payment information.

[0040] With the development of internet technology, users can now make payments through various internet-based methods in offline payment scenarios, such as QR code payments. Internet-based payments have improved the user experience. To further enhance payment efficiency, for small-amount payments, users are allowed to use authentication-free methods (also known as password-free payments). This means users do not need to perform any authentication (such as payment passwords, fingerprints, or facial recognition); they only need to provide their payment account information to the receiving device (e.g., in the form of a payment code) to complete the payment.

[0041] Taking QR code payment as an example, after completing a purchase, a user can display their payment code on their terminal device to the payment receiving device. Upon scanning the payment code, the receiving device establishes a connection with the payment server and sends a payment request to complete the payment process. In this method, the user does not need to perform authentication; they only need to display the payment code, thus improving payment efficiency.

[0042] However, precisely because payments can be made without authentication, if a thief steals a user's payment account information, they can use that information to make payments, leading to financial losses for the user. Let's take the QR code payment scenario again. If a user's payment code is obtained by a thief through screenshotting software or taking a photo, the thief can use it to make payments. Furthermore, currently, payment codes are mostly immutable for a long period after generation, meaning they have a certain timeframe. If a thief steals the code, they can use it multiple times within that timeframe to make payments.

[0043] To address the aforementioned technical problems, this specification provides the following solution:

[0044] The receiving device generates verification information for the current target payment transaction and provides the verification information to the paying device. The paying device generates payment information based on the verification information and the payment account information and provides the payment information to the receiving device. After obtaining the payment information, the receiving device verifies the payment information using the locally generated verification information. Only after successful verification will it use the account information carried in the payment information to complete the payment request.

[0045] Based on the above explanation, as Figure 1 As shown in the figure, this specification provides a payment verification method, as follows:

[0046] S101, the receiving device generates verification information for the target payment transaction to be processed and provides the verification information to the payment device;

[0047] In scenarios where the payer provides payment account information for payment, the receiving device typically needs to first obtain information such as the specific payment amount, then wait to acquire the payment account information. After acquiring the payment account information, it establishes a connection with the payment server and completes the payment. The receiving device can determine the payment amount and other information based on the user's input to identify an pending payment transaction. For example, in a payment scenario, either the payer or payee can scan the item to be paid using the receiving device, thus identifying an pending payment transaction. Alternatively, the receiving device can directly input the payment amount or item to be paid, confirming the existence of an pending payment transaction.

[0048] When the receiving device determines that there is a pending target payment transaction, it can generate verification information for that transaction and provide it to the payment device. The generated verification information can be various types of information generated for the target payment transaction. For example, it can be one or more of the following: the current time, the payment amount of the target payment transaction, the payee information of the target payment transaction, or a random number generated based on the current time. Any information that can be used to identify the current target payment transaction can be used as verification information, and this specification does not limit this.

[0049] For example, the verification information generated based on the target payment transaction A could be a random number X generated based on the current time and the payment amount Y of the target payment transaction A. The receiving device can then record the information locally as shown in Table 1.

[0050] Target payment transaction Verification information A X and Y

[0051] Table 1

[0052] The specific method by which the receiving device provides verification information to the payment device will not be detailed here, but can be found in the following content.

[0053] S102, the payment device generates payment information and provides the payment information to the receiving device. The payment information carries: payment account information and the obtained verification information.

[0054] After receiving the verification information from the receiving device, the payment device can generate payment information based on the received verification information. The payment information may include: payment account information, the obtained verification information, and / or other user payment information. After generating the payment information, it can be sent to the receiving device. Referring to the example in S101 above, the payment information can include a verification information random number X and a payment amount Y.

[0055] In one embodiment, the payment information may be a payment QR code, which may be encoded from the account information and the verification information. In other embodiments, the payment information may exist in other forms, which are not limited herein.

[0056] Taking the payment information as a payment QR code as an example, the payment device can display the payment QR code as an image on the interactive interface, so that the receiving device can obtain the payment information by scanning the QR code.

[0057] The payment device can also transmit the payment QR code information to the receiving device via wireless signals, such as through NFC communication technology, so that the receiving device can obtain the payment QR code information and thus obtain the payment information.

[0058] Of course, the payment device can also transmit other forms of payment information to the receiving device wirelessly. For example, instead of encoding it into a payment QR code, the payment information in other forms can be sent directly to the receiving device. This manual does not limit this. Compared with displaying a payment QR code image, wireless transmission is more convenient for users. Users do not need to display a payment code image; they only need to bring the payment device close to the receiving device to complete the payment process, which is more conducive to improving the user experience.

[0059] S103, after obtaining the payment information, the receiving device performs a matching verification using the verification information carried in the payment information and the locally generated verification information; if the verification is successful, the payment request is completed using the account information carried in the payment information.

[0060] After receiving payment information from the payment device, the receiving device can parse the payment information to obtain verification information and payment account information. For example, referring to the example in S102 above, if the payment information is a payment QR code, the receiving device can parse the payment QR code to obtain the verification information and payment account information.

[0061] After obtaining the verification information, the device can retrieve the generated verification information locally and use the verification information carried in the payment information and the locally generated verification information for matching and verification. Combining the examples of S101 and S102 above, the receiving device can determine whether the verification information carried in the payment information is the random number X and payment amount Y corresponding to the target transaction A. If so, the matching and verification is successful.

[0062] If the matching verification is successful, it means that the payment information is used to pay the current target payment transaction. Therefore, the payment request can be completed using the account information carried in the payment information. That is, a connection can be established with the payment server. After the connection is established, the account information carried in the payment information can be sent to the payment server to complete the payment request.

[0063] If the matching verification fails, it means that the payment information does not carry the verification information used to pay the current target payment transaction. It can be directly determined that the payment information is invalid, so the payment account information will not be obtained to further complete the payment request.

[0064] By adopting the technical solution in this specification, since the receiving device generates verification information for the target payment transaction and provides it to the payment device, and the payment device uses this verification information to generate payment information, the payment information provided by the payment device to the receiving device is only for the current target payment transaction. Therefore, even if a thief steals this payment information, they cannot use it to pay for other transactions. For the user, no authentication operation is required, thus ensuring payment efficiency while improving payment security.

[0065] The following describes the specific method by which the receiving device provides verification information to the payment device in S101 above.

[0066] like Figure 2 As shown, in a specific embodiment, the process can be:

[0067] S201, The receiving device generates and broadcasts a first wireless signal carrying verification information;

[0068] In conjunction with S101 above, after determining that there is a target payment transaction to be processed and generating the corresponding verification information, the receiving device can directly generate a first wireless signal carrying the verification information and broadcast the first wireless signal. This wireless signal can be in various forms, such as NFC or Bluetooth.

[0069] S202, after the payment device detects the first wireless signal, it obtains verification information from the first wireless signal.

[0070] In offline payment scenarios, since the payment device and the receiving device are close to each other, the first wireless signal can be detected, and the verification information can be obtained from it.

[0071] like Figure 3 As shown, in another specific embodiment, the process can also be:

[0072] S301, The payment device generates and broadcasts a second wireless signal carrying a request to obtain verification information;

[0073] The payment device can generate a verification information retrieval request and add the verification information retrieval request to a second wireless signal for broadcast.

[0074] In this system, the payment device can generate and broadcast a second wireless signal carrying a verification information acquisition request when it determines that a payment request exists. For example, it can determine that a payment request exists when it detects a user's triggering action. In a QR code payment scenario, it can determine that a payment request exists when it detects a user's display of a payment code.

[0075] The payment device can also generate and broadcast a second wireless signal carrying a verification information request when it detects the presence of a payment device nearby. For example, it can determine the presence of a payment device after detecting the NFC or Bluetooth signal of the payment device.

[0076] S302, after the receiving device detects the second wireless signal, it sends a third wireless signal carrying verification information to the payment device;

[0077] After detecting the second wireless signal broadcast by the payment device, the receiving device can add the payment information corresponding to the target payment transaction to the third wireless signal and send it to the payment device.

[0078] In order to save the processing resources of the payment receiving device, in this embodiment, the payment receiving device may detect the second wireless signal sent by the payment device and then generate verification information for the current target payment transaction to be processed.

[0079] Of course, in other embodiments, verification information may be generated immediately after it is determined that there is a target payment transaction to be processed, and this specification does not limit this.

[0080] S303, the payment device obtains verification information from the third wireless signal.

[0081] The payment device can obtain the verification information from the third wireless signal it receives.

[0082] The above Figure 2 and Figure 3 Neither of the two methods requires any additional action from the payer or payee. The payment and receiving devices can exchange information without the user's awareness, thus ensuring payment efficiency while also improving payment security.

[0091] The technical solution disclosed in this specification is described below with reference to a specific embodiment:

[0092] After shopping at the supermarket, a customer arrives at the checkout counter. The cashier scans each item purchased using a payment device. Once scanned, the device identifies an pending payment transaction and generates verification information, including the current time, transaction amount, and payment account information. This verification information is then broadcast via Bluetooth. The customer's mobile device detects this signal, retrieves the verification information, and generates a payment QR code containing both the verification information and the payment account information. When the customer clicks to display the payment QR code, it is shown on their mobile device. The payment device then scans the QR code to establish a connection with the payment server and complete the payment process.

[0093] As can be seen, since the generated payment QR code can only be used to pay for this specific target payment transaction, even if the victim obtains it through methods such as taking a photo or screenshot, they will not be able to use the payment QR code to pay for other transactions. Therefore, payment security in password-free payment scenarios is improved.
